Conditional sentences have two parts or clauses that give a condition in the dependent clause and a result in the independent clause. The condition clause usually contains an if statement. There are several different forms of conditional sentences that allow the writer to express various meanings using different tenses.

Mixed conditionals are conditional sentences that combine elements of type II conditionals and type III conditionals.They are used to describe a hypothetical or unreal situation in the present or future that is connected to a hypothetical or unreal situation in the past.In other words, mixed conditionals describe a present or future situation that is the result of a past hypothetical event

Type III. Conditional sentences of the third type are used to describe conditions in the past. If something had been the case, the present state of things would be different now. The third type always refers to the past and can never become real. If-clause in the past perfect + main clause with "would/could/might" + "have" + past participle.
The third conditional is used to express the past consequence of an unrealistic action or situation in the past. For example, If he had studied harder, he would have passed the exam.
